Exploring varied occupation routes within the contemporary financial sector
Wiki Article
The monetary services industry remains a source of impressive professional potential for ambitious professionals looking for fulfilling career paths. Modern financial markets encompasses numerous specialisations that accommodate varied abilities and professional aspirations. Understanding these pathways can assist professionals in planning their future.
Opportunities in accounting within the financial services sector extend far beyond traditional accounting roles, encompassing advanced spheres such as forensic financial auditing, management accounting, and global financial standards compliance. Modern financial specialists collaborate with governing authorities, guaranteeing that banks maintain transparency and comply with increasingly complex governing structures. These roles require a deep understanding of economic theories, meticulous focus to specifics, and the ability to communicate complex financial information to varied stakeholders such as board representatives, authorities, and outside evaluators. Professional growth often follows well-defined routes from entry-level accounting roles via to senior accountant roles and ultimately, financial controller and chief financial officer positions. Wealth management careers focus on delivering in-depth economic consultation to high-net-worth individuals, families, and organizations looking to protect and increase their wealth throughout generations. This specialisation requires an extraordinary blend of economic expertise, interpersonal skills, and discretion when dealing with sensitive client information and substantial asset portfolios. Wealth managers typically establish long-term relationships with their clients, providing holistic advice addressing investment strategies, tax strategies, estate management, and philanthropic activities. The position requires ongoing education to stay abreast of evolving market conditions, regulatory requirements, and cutting-edge investment products that may benefit clients. Investment banking careers embody among the most esteemed and challenging financial jobs, enticing top-tier talent from leading universities globally. These positions typically involve providing counsel to businesses, governments and organizations on complex financial dealings such as business mergers and acquisitions, initial public offerings, and financial refinancing. The rigor of this sector requires extraordinary analytical skills, precision, and the capability to perform under high stress while maintaining the utmost standards of client service. Experts in this field typically begin as entry-level positions, advancing through team lead and vice executive levels before potentially reaching senior leadership roles. Positions in corporate finance and opportunities in managing risk signify crucial functions within banks, ensuring organizations make prudent financial decisions while preserving suitable risk indicators. Finance gurus analyze potential investments, evaluate capital allocation strategies, and structure financing arrangements that support business growth objectives.
